保护光电转换装置告警在线采集系统与保护通道故障自动分析定位方法研究 被引量:6

Study on the alarm on-line acquisition system for protection photoelectric conversion device and automatic analysis and localization method for protection channel fault

摘要 针对保护光电转换装置告警信息不能在线监测的问题,设计了基于树莓派的保护光电转换装置的在线采集系统。提出了综合利用采集到的保护光电转换装置告警信息与传输设备专业网管告警信息,对保护通道故障进行自动分析判断的流程。所提出的在线监测系统和故障自动分析判断流程,省去了现场查看保护光电转换装置告警的步骤,简化了保护和通信两专业人工协调分析的程序,对及早发现和定位故障区段,提升保护通道故障排查处理的智能化水平有积极意义。 Focused on the problem that the protection photoelectric conversion device alarm information can not be monitored on-line, the alarm acquisition system based on the Raspberry Pi is proposed for the protection photoelectric conversion device. The automatical analyzing and judging flow is proposed for the protection channel fault, which is based on the comprehensive analysis of the alarm information about protection photoelectric conversion device and professional network management system of the transmission equipment. Via the proposed on-line monitoring system and the fault automatic analysis and judgement procedure, the step of spot investigation of the alarm information for the protection photoelectric conversion device is saved, and the procedure of coordination and analysis by the two kinds of experts, including the communication and protection ones, is simplified. It has positive significance for detecting and locating the protection channel fault section early, improving the intelligent level of the protection channel fault searching and processing.
